Why Ventura County Tenants Need Support

Rapid Legal Timeline

Ventura County tenants are often caught off guard by how fast evictions proceed. A notice to pay or quit can quickly escalate into an Unlawful Detainer lawsuit, and you have only 5 to 10 days to respond. Without quick action, you risk losing by default.

High Stakes in Default Judgments

Countless renters are forced out because they didn’t file legal court documents on time. When that happens, the landlord can ask the court for a default judgment and gain legal authority to remove the tenant without ever presenting evidence in court.

Landlord Intimidation

Landlords often have attorneys who know the system. Tenants deserve knowledgeable support to level the playing field. With the right help, you can assert your rights and challenge improper landlord actions.

Strict and Complex Paperwork

California’s eviction paperwork must be filed correctly and on time. Any mistake or delay can jeopardize your case. Properly filed legal court documents are crucial to stopping an eviction.
